سورس برنامه پخش کننده موسیقی به زبان سی شارپ
سورس برنامه پخش کننده موسیقی به زبان سی شارپ
برنامههای پخش کننده موسیقی به زبان سی شارپ معمولاً با استفاده از کتابخانههای متنوعی ساخته میشوند. این کتابخانهها امکاناتی برای پخش، متوقف کردن، و مدیریت فایلهای صوتی فراهم میکنند. در ادامه، به بررسی اجزای اصلی یک پخش کننده موسیقی به زبان سی شارپ میپردازیم.
۱. انتخاب کتابخانه مناسب
برای پخش صوت، کتابخانههایی مانند NAudio و CSCore بسیار متداول هستند. این کتابخانهها قابلیتهای متنوعی ارائه میدهند و کار با آنها نسبتاً آسان است.
۲. طراحی رابط کاربری
رابط کاربری معمولاً شامل دکمههایی برای پخش، توقف و جلو و عقب رفتن در آهنگها است. با استفاده از Windows Forms یا WPF میتوانید یک رابط کاربری جذاب طراحی کنید.
```csharp
private void btnPlay_Click(object sender, EventArgs e)
{
using (var audioFile = new AudioFileReader("path_to_audio_file"))
using (var outputDevice = new WaveOutEvent())
{
outputDevice.Init(audioFile);
outputDevice.Play();
}
}
```
۳. مدیریت فایلهای صوتی
برنامه شما باید قابلیت بارگذاری فایلهای صوتی مختلف را داشته باشد. این امر میتواند با استفاده از OpenFileDialog انجام شود تا کاربر بتواند فایلهای مورد نظر خود را انتخاب کند.
```csharp
OpenFileDialog openFileDialog = new OpenFileDialog();
if (openFileDialog.ShowDialog() == DialogResult.OK)
{
// بارگذاری فایل صوتی
string filePath = openFileDialog.FileName;
}
```
۴. افزودن ویژگیهای اضافی
شما میتوانید ویژگیهای اضافی مانند لیست پخش، تغییر حجم صدا و نمایش اطلاعات آهنگ را اضافه کنید. این ویژگیها تجربه کاربری را بهبود میبخشند.
۵. تست و بهینهسازی
قبل از انتشار برنامه، اطمینان حاصل کنید که تمامی قابلیتها به درستی کار میکنند. تست دقیق و بهینهسازی کدها برای عملکرد بهتر ضروری است.
نتیجهگیری
ایجاد یک پخش کننده موسیقی به زبان سی شارپ میتواند چالشبرانگیز و در عین حال لذتبخش باشد. با استفاده از منابع مناسب و طراحی دقیق، شما میتوانید یک برنامه کاربردی و کاربرپسند بسازید.محصول: سورس نرمافزار مدیریت موسیقی MP3 در سی شارپ
این نرمافزار بهطور ویژه طراحی شده است تا به کاربران امکان مدیریت، سازماندهی و پخش موسیقیهای MP3 را فراهم کند.
در ابتدا، این سورس کد به توسعهدهندگان این امکان را میدهد که با استفاده از زبان برنامهنویسی سی شارپ، به راحتی پروژههای خود را راهاندازی کنند.
ویژگیهای کلیدی این نرمافزار شامل:
۱. رابط کاربری کاربرپسند: طراحی ساده و کاربردی، تجربهای لذتبخش برای کاربران فراهم میکند.
۲. مدیریت فایلهای MP3: قابلیت افزودن، حذف و ویرایش اطلاعات موسیقی به طور مؤثر.
۳. پخش موسیقی: پخش فایلهای صوتی با کیفیت بالا، بدون افت کیفیت صدا.
۴. جستجوی سریع: کاربران میتوانند بهراحتی به جستجوی آهنگها و آلبومهای مورد علاقه خود بپردازند.
۵. سازگاری با سیستمهای مختلف: این نرمافزار قابلیت اجرا بر روی سیستمعاملهای ویندوز را دارد.
این سورس نرمافزاری نه تنها برای توسعهدهندگان حرفهای بلکه برای تازهکاران نیز مناسب است. با یادگیری و استفاده از این ابزار، میتوانید مهارتهای برنامهنویسی خود را ارتقا دهید.
در نهایت، این محصول میتواند گزینهای عالی برای کسانی باشد که به دنبال ایجاد یک پلتفرم موسیقی شخصی یا تجاری هستند.
باکس دانلود (سورس برنامه پخش کننده موسیقی به زبان سی شارپ)
دانلود
پیشنهاد برای دانلود ( سورس برنامه پخش کننده موسیقی به زبان سی شارپ )
نظرات کاربران (۳)
مریم احمدی
عالی بود .. با تشکر